New hope for hepatitis d: phase 3 trial of libevitug launches

NCT ID NCT07499544

First seen Apr 04, 2026 · Last updated Jun 14, 2026 · Updated 12 times

Summary

This study tests a new medicine called libevitug in 160 adults with chronic hepatitis D, a serious liver infection. The goal is to see if libevitug can lower the virus in the blood and improve liver health. Participants will receive the drug and be monitored for 48 weeks.
